Aerial images produced by UASs can be taken daily in order to plan the placement of stored materials the flow of workers and vehicles in and around the site and to identify potential issues with installed construction or the constructability of planned installations. Construction site aerial imaging is an efficient cost-effective tool that allows contractors and land developers to effectively manage all stages of the construction progress from planning to completion while keeping timelines on schedule staying within budget and providing accurate information to stakeholders along the way.
